Panama City has an insanely beautiful long stretch of waterfront park called Cinta Costera where you can go running, biking, do yoga, use free workout equipment, play basketball, soccer, volleyball, tennis, ping pong, or just sit on a bench and people-watch while enjoying a raspao snow cone.

Panama City only has three official gay clubs, but there are a lot of gay-friendly establishments and events to know about.
